Output 995e61d89d984f16462be66132e3e465159359403a43dcf81af152d96b951d4e:1

value
31700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 289f146a1177e60ba03cd71bf22e9776fc7daeed OP_EQUALVERIFY OP_CHECKSIG
address
14hnbjCXvYeFzX2YAfSS5WjNsHt5Hcohtz
transaction
995e61d89d984f16462be66132e3e465159359403a43dcf81af152d96b951d4e
spent
true